REITs invest in the majority of real estate property types, including offices, apartment buildings, warehouses, retail centers, medical facilities, data centers, cell towers and hotels.

Billy Wright is a managing director with Wells Fargo’s Real Estate, Gaming, Lodging, and Leisure (REGAL) Group. He has been involved in strategic transactions and public and private debt and equity financings for both public REITs and private real estate companies for more than 15 years.
